All-New Wolverine monthly ongoing series is back with its second story arc, which serves as a tie-in to the Civil War II crossover event from Marvel Comics in 2016 and collects issues #07-12 of the series.

all new wolverine gabby
The Shocking Prediction

The storyline was conceived by writer Tom Taylor (Injustice – Gods Among Us – Year One, Injustice – Gods Among Us – Year Two), drawn by artists Ig Guara and Marcio Takara, while covers were done by Bengal (All-New Wolverine – The Four Sisters, Avengers World – Before Time Runs Out). Wolverine's journey is followed up next in "Enemy of the State II" storyline.

The third monthly ongoing series of Uncanny Avengers is back with second storyline of their run on 2016, which collects issues #07-12 from the aforementioned series of Marvel Comics. This plotline is written by veteran comic-book writer Gerry Duggan (Arkham Manor, Hawkeye Vs. Deadpool), who is the current series regular narrator.

Artists Pepe Larraz (Fear Itself – The Home Front, New Avengers – Luke Cage) and Ryan Stegman (Scarlet Spider, Wolverine) assisted him with drawing. It is a tie-in to "Avengers – Standoff!" crossover event and served as part of that story. Professor X and Gambit of X-Men made short cameo in between to tease their involvement in future.

Following his first-ever run on All-New, All-Different Avengers monthly series with "The Magnificent Seven" storyline, writer Mark Waid (Captain America – Sentinel of Liberty, Deadpool – Sins of the Past) returns in 2016 for a second round in "Family Business" and paving way for next arc that would tie-in during "Civil War II" crossover event.

Pencilers Adam Kubert (Astonishing Spider-Man & Wolverine, Avengers & X-Men – Axis) and Mahmud Asrar (Indestructible Hulk – Humanity Bomb, Wolverine and the X-Men – Tomorrow Never Learns) would join Waid as series regular along with guest-artist Alan Davis (Fantastic Four – The End, Savage Hulk – The Man Within).

"Lost Future" is a six-issue storyline that took place on third ongoing volume of Uncanny Avengers monthly series from Marvel Comics in 2016.

The story was plotted out by veteran comic-book writer Gerry Duggan (Arkham Manor, Hawkeye Vs. Deadpool), who was aided by artists Carlos Pacheco (Bishop, Fantastic Four) and Ryan Stegman (Scarlet Spider, Wolverine) for this project.

uncanny avengers marvel comics
Menace of Shredded Man

The first four issues are mainly focused on the newly introduced villainous character Shredded Man, who is a byproduct of the Terrigen Cloud, originated from the event when Inhuman King Black Bolt detonated a bomb containing Terrigen Mist to unleash a massive growth in their numbers during Thanos' invasion on Earth (Infinity).

Then the Unity Division team of Avengers encounters a recently resurfaced Red Skull impersonating as X-Men member Gambit along with his daughter Sin. The story is then followed up by "The Man Who Fell to Earth", which also features the return of one of their deadliest foes as well as a founding member of The Avengers.

In a post-Battleworld reality, writer Mark Waid (Captain America – Sentinel of Liberty, Deadpool – Sins of the Past) was brought in to reform The Avengers with new a group of heroes and he attempts to reinvent one of Marvel Comics' most iconic groups of superheroes by pitting them against one of their recurring enemies from past.

Joining Waid in story collaboration process are artists Adam Kubert (Astonishing Spider-Man & Wolverine, Avengers & X-Men – Axis) and Mahmud Asrar (Indestructible Hulk – Humanity Bomb, Wolverine and the X-Men – Tomorrow Never Learns) with cover arts for related issues provided by legendary illustrator Alex Ross (Kingdom Come, Marvels).
